Noun [Italian]

IPA: /viˈad.d͡ʒo/ Forms: viaggi [plural]
Rhymes: -addʒo Etymology: Borrowed from Old Occitan viatge and Old French viage, veiage, from Latin viāticum, from the adjective viāticus, from via (“road, path”) + -āticus (“pertaining to”). By surface analysis, via + -aggio. Doublet of viatico and cognate to Catalan viatge, French and English voyage, Spanish viaje, Portuguese viagem, Norman viage, Sicilian viaggiu, Maltese vjaġġ, Romanian voiaj.   1. journey, trip, tour, voyage Tags: masculine Categories (topical): Travel

  2. (also in the plural) travels, travel, travelling/traveling Tags: also, in-plural, masculine

Derived forms: viaggetto, viaggiare, viaggiatore, viaggiatrice, viaggio di nozze Related terms: via, viatico
